Not sure on the extent of the activities of the actual department outside administering the required rhetoric classes. Most undergrad schools require that you take a composition class as a freshman. At Iowa, they name that class "rhetoric" and incorporate some public speaking. Some students are only required to take one semester of "accelerated" rhetoric (as of 2007, could be different now), others take it both semesters.
